Ingredients
2 1/2CupsWhite Chocolate Chips
1Can Sweetened Condensed Milk
1TbspButter
PinchSalt
Green Leaf Gel Food Coloring
Large Red Heart Sprinkles
Instructions
Line an 8x8 square baking pan with aluminum foil or parchment paper and butter.
Place the sweetened condensed milk and the white chocolate chips in a medium size saucepan and heat over medium heat, stirring frequently, until the chocolate chips have melted. Add in the butter and a pinch of salt and continue stirring and heating over low heat until the butter has melted and is completely incorporated.
Place about 1/8 tsp of green gel food coloring into the white chocolate fudge mixture and stir until well incorporated. Add additional food coloring if a deeper green color is desired.
Pour the fudge mixture into the prepared baking dish and spread it evenly.
Place sprinkles across the top of the fudge evenly in 5 rows of 5. When you cut the fudge each piece will have a heart in the center. If you prefer larger pieces of fudge you can use less sprinkles and spread them out more.
Place the fudge in the refrigerator and allow to cool for at least 4 hours.
When ready to serve slice the fudge with a clean sharp knife into 25 squares.
Store any leftover fudge refrigerated in an airtight container.
